OneWireless Gauge Reader

Honeywell’s OneWireless™ Gauge Reader non-invasively clips to the front face of existing gauges to enable remote monitoring of gauge readings. Installation takes minutes and does not require removing old gauges, breaking pressure seals, performing leak checks, running wires or interrupting the underlying process. Adapters are available to fit most size and type of manual gauges for pressure, temperature, vacuum and other measurements.

In older manufacturing plants, hundreds or thousands of manual gauges monitor a variety of parameters related to equipment health, consumables usage or non real-time process variables. Many of these are important to the overall plant uptime, yield and throughput. However, many are not systematically monitored, trended or alarmed in real-time. Abnormal situations may remain undetected, leading to unsafe conditions, unplanned downtime or asset degradation. And, manual monitoring makes it difficult to accurately track and optimize resource usage.

The OneWireless Gauge Reader dramatically reduces the cost, time and disruption necessary to automate gauge monitoring and integrates seamlessly with the OneWireless architecture for scalability and compatibility with future wireless standards.

Benefits include:

  • Improved asset management and uptime - More frequent monitoring and trending of parameters enable earlier detection, notification and correction of issues.
  • Faster troubleshooting - Historical data helps to quickly pinpoint time and related events leading to failures.
  • Energy savings - Monitors high energy consuming areas (such as compressed air systems) for optimal operation/pressures: not too high to waste energy, but not too low to affect process.
  • Energy audits - Gather baseline energy consumption data (such as steam, chiller or air handler temperature and flow) quickly and non-invasively.
  • Reduced consumables usage - Monitor gas cylinders and change them out at the right time to optimize usage and avoid running out of gas.
  • Better yield/quality - Feed more extensive data into statistical process control models or advanced control models for reduced variation and improved quality/yield.
  • Safer and more efficient employees - Redeploy employees from reading gauges to more critical tasks and minimize the need to go to hazardous or remote locations. In addition, ensure that tanks and cylinders are at a safe pressure.
